Abstract

Introduction. The paper examines the main types of anchor piles used in geotechnical construction are examined in terms of their design variants, the scope of their application, advantages and disadvantages, designs and types of drill bits depending on the type of soil foundation. The aim of the study is the search for and analysis of existing domestic and foreign designs of drill-and-injection anchor piles used for strengthening existing foundations and bases, for dowel reinforcing landslide slopes and different installations such as caissons, retaining walls, masts, towers and pillars bearing pull out loads as well as discovering new, previously little-known anchor designs. The objectives of the study are to perform a patent search and a literary review of existing designs of drill-and-injection anchor piles. Materials and methods. Systematization, structural, comparative and contrastive analyses. The paper also utilized the theoretical generalization of the data obtained in the detailed analysis of literature and patent data containing information about the previously developed and applied designs of anchor piles were used in the search and selection of relevant literature. Results. The application of the anchor piles is of great importance in modern foreign and domestic geotechnical practice. The need for their application is connected with ensuring the safety of construction, reducing the period of foundation work execution, and the economic efficiency of approved engineering solutions. Conclusions. It was found that despite a large number of anchor pile types, all of them, as a rule, are made the using technology of the company Bauer. It is revealed that commonly the anchor design consists of three main parts: a head (supporting element), a rod (element transferring the load from the anchor head to its root) and an anchor root (element transferring the load from reinforced structure to ground and foundation soil).
